ZPS America will be hosting its first Technology Days event during the NTMA Conference in Indianapolis, IN, October 7-9, 2009. The new facility will be open and all are invited to attend machine demonstrations, facility tours and technical sessions put on by ZPS America and their technology partners. On another note, ZPS has become the factory-authorized North American source for full customer support, including service, machine rebuilding, applications support, parts, training, and sales for the TAJMAC-ZPS line of cam-driven multi-spindle automatic lathes. zpsamerica.com
